#b0bb6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0bb6d is composed of 69% red, 73.3%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 68.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 58%. #b0bb6d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#617700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#b0bb6d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b0bb6d has RGB values of R:176, G:187,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11582317.

Shades and Tints of #b0bb6d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f3 is the lightest one.
